I've noticed that at some of my airports the tower view is not where the tower is, in fact it is often in mid-air not at a structure at all. Has anybody seen this and is there a fix for it.

Some airports such as Seatle-Tacoma used to have the correct tower view but they don't now.

A tower can be added or moved using the free Afcad program by Lee Swordy.

To move one, just open the airport in question and look for the little symbol on the afcad which has a T in it - on mine it shows as a pink circle with the T.  

Clicking on an existing one will show the coordinates and elevation - all of which can be edited.

If just moving one, click on it and drag it to your preferred location.

To add one, click on the Insert label and select Tower - a screen will display and you can set the location by clicking on the proper spot on your afcad.  You can even place the view in a Tower object (using a corrected elevation) to simulate the view from the Control Tower itself.

I've discovered something.
Opa discribes in one of his tricks & tips about going to map mode and dragging the aircraft icon to change the location. The same can be done with the tower and you can pinpoint the location by lattitude/longitude and altitude. Unfortunately it only re-locates it for that flight.
For Seattle-Tacoma for instance I flew the aircraft directly over the tower, paused, went to map and dragged the tower icon to the aircraft icon and it worked.
Can anyone suggest a way to perminently save the tower location? ;)
